Homework Help Overview
The problem involves two identical ideal massless springs attached to a small cube, which are stretched from their natural length of 0.25m to a length of 0.32m. An external force is applied to the cube, pulling it a distance of 0.020m to the right. The discussion centers around calculating the work required to stretch the springs and position the cube as described.
